Table des matières:

Comment faire une console Attiny85 - ArduPlay : 5 étapes (avec photos)
Comment faire une console Attiny85 - ArduPlay : 5 étapes (avec photos)

Vidéo: Comment faire une console Attiny85 - ArduPlay : 5 étapes (avec photos)

Vidéo: Comment faire une console Attiny85 - ArduPlay : 5 étapes (avec photos)
Vidéo: On se fabrique une console éco+ [1] 2024, Novembre
Anonim

C'était comme ça: je parcourais des vidéos YouTube sans but pour me détendre autour d'une tasse de thé. Peut-être les moments forts d'un match de football ou une compilation de vidéos amusantes ? Soudain, j'ai reçu une notification sur mon téléphone - une nouvelle vidéo sur la chaîne Electronoobs. Malheureusement, ce temps du soir ne me filera pas entre les doigts. Il a fait un projet intéressant du jeu attiny, mais je n'ai pas aimé la façon d'installer le nouveau jeu, car si vous voulez changer le jeu, vous devez retirer le microcontrôleur du connecteur et en brancher un nouveau, ce qui peut affecter négativement sur les jambes attiny. Je me sentais obligé d'améliorer la façon de changer le jeu. Commençons!

Étape 1: Insertion du jeu

Insertion du jeu
Insertion du jeu
Insertion du jeu
Insertion du jeu
Insertion du jeu
Insertion du jeu

J'ai commencé par chercher des connecteurs qui conviendraient à ce projet. J'en ai trouvé un qui a un ressort à l'intérieur, donc je peux insérer le plateau de jeu, puis l'appuyer. À la perfection. En utilisant le schéma du créateur Internet mentionné précédemment, j'ai créé mon propre schéma, en ajoutant des connecteurs et une batterie que je peux charger via un connecteur micro USB. Ensuite, j'ai conçu des PCB pour la console et les cartes de jeu et les ai commandés auprès de NEXTPCB.

Étape 2: Préparation du PCB

Préparation PCB
Préparation PCB
Préparation PCB
Préparation PCB

C'est l'heure de la soudure. J'ai commencé par appliquer de la pâte à souder sur tous les plots des composants SMD, puis j'ai mis ces éléments à leur place. J'ai réglé la station d'air chaud à 300 degrés, le débit d'air au plus petit et j'ai commencé le processus de soudure - résistances, condensateurs, interrupteurs, prises, écran. Enfin, j'ai soudé les connecteurs dorés. Après avoir inséré l'écran dans le socket goldpin, il s'est avéré qu'il dépassait trop, j'ai donc dessoudé le socket et soudé l'écran lui-même. Enfin, j'ai nettoyé le PCB avec de l'alcool isopropylique et une brosse à dents.

Étape 3: Projection

En saillie
En saillie
En saillie
En saillie
En saillie
En saillie

J'ai pris des photos des deux planches et les ai téléchargées sur Fusion 360. J'ai entré les dimensions de la planche, marqué les endroits que le boîtier ne devait pas couvrir, réglé l'épaisseur de cet élément à 2 mm et l'ai imprimé pour m'assurer que les trous étaient dans le bons endroits. Ensuite, j'ai créé le fond du boîtier et les ai connectés ensemble. L'ensemble du boîtier se compose de 6 éléments. Lorsque j'ai fini de le concevoir, je l'ai téléchargé dans Creality Slicer et je l'ai enregistré sur la carte SD dans deux fichiers. J'utiliserai du PLA rouge uni pour imprimer les éléments du premier fichier et du PLA en bois pour ceux du deuxième fichier. Ce filament est composé à 40 % de pâte mécanique qui, une fois imprimée, crée un parfum unique. Ces filaments m'ont été fournis par 3DJAKE - je vous encourage à consulter leur offre. Il ne restait plus qu'à assembler tous les éléments.

Étape 4: Programmation Attiny

Programmation Attiny
Programmation Attiny

Le microcontrôleur attiny85, que je vais dessouder du module digispark, se chargera du fonctionnement de la partie électronique. Avant de faire cela, cependant, je dois le programmer. J'ai installé les pilotes de ce module, puis j'ai ajouté une bibliothèque prenant en charge ce module à l'IDE Arduino. J'ai téléchargé les fichiers du jeu et les ai téléchargés sur quelques tableaux afin que je puisse changer le jeu à tout moment. J'ai dessoudé attiny du module digispark et je l'ai soudé à mon PCB.

Étape 5: C'est tout

C'est tout!
C'est tout!
C'est tout!
C'est tout!

Voici à quoi ressemble arduPlay - une mini-console de jeux basée sur attiny85. Placez le plateau de jeu au bon endroit et fermez le boîtier, en appuyant ainsi le plateau sur les connecteurs. Vous pouvez désormais profiter d'un gameplay de style rétro sur votre mini console fabriquée à la main.

Mon Youtube: YouTube

Mon Facebook: Facebook

Mon Instagram: Instagram

Commandez votre propre PCB: NEXTPCB

Boutique d'accessoires pour l'impression 3D: 3DJAKE

Conseillé: